What is a 45' Container?
A 45-foot container is a standardized shipping container that determines 45 feet in length, making it longer than the more typical 40-foot and 20-foot containers. It is mostly used for transporting bulk items and is especially popular in the maritime shipping industry. The 45' container is designed to make the most of cargo space while keeping the structural integrity and safety standards needed for global transport.
Dimensions of a 45' Container
- Length: 45 feet (13.716 meters)
- Width: 8 feet (2.438 meters)
- Height: 9 feet 6 inches (2.9 meters) for basic height containers, and 9 feet 6 inches to 10 feet 6 inches (3.2 meters) for high cube containers
- Internal Volume: Approximately 3,460 cubic feet (98 cubic meters) for standard height containers and 3,660 cubic feet (104 cubic meters) for high cube containers
- Optimum Gross Weight: Up to 67,200 pounds (30,480 kilograms)
Types of 45' Containers
Requirement 45' Container:
- The basic 45' container is the most typical type and is used for a vast array of items. It has a typical height of 8 feet 6 inches and is appropriate for the majority of cargo that does not require unique handling or conditions.
High Cube 45' Container:
- The high cube 45' container is a little taller, determining 9 feet 6 inches to 10 feet 6 inches in height. This extra height offers additional vertical space, making it perfect for large or tall products.
Cooled 45' Container:
- Refrigerated containers, likewise understood as reefer containers, are geared up with temperature control systems. They are used for transferring perishable items such as fruits, vegetables, pharmaceuticals, and frozen products.
Open Top 45' Container:
- Open top containers have a removable roofing system, permitting the loading and unloading of oversized or heavy cargo that can not fit through the basic door. These containers are frequently utilized for equipment, building materials, and other large items.
Flat Rack 45' Container:
- Flat rack containers are open on the sides and can be set up with or without end walls. They are created for transferring oversized and heavy cargo that requires direct access from multiple sides, such as cars, boats, and heavy equipment.
Benefits of Using a 45' Container
Increased Cargo Capacity:
- The 45' container provides more space compared to a 40' container, making it ideal for companies that require to carry large volumes of goods. This can reduce the variety of containers required, leading to cost savings.
Cost Efficiency:
- Despite being longer, the 45' container often uses a lower cost per cubic foot of 45ft cargo containers space. This makes it an economical option for shipping bulk goods.
Versatility:
- The 45' container is available in different types, consisting of high cube, refrigerated, open top, and flat rack, which enables it to accommodate a wide variety of cargo types and sizes.
Standardization:
- The 45' container adheres to worldwide shipping requirements, which guarantees it can be quickly managed and transported by standard 45ft container capacity cranes, trucks, and railcars. This standardization facilitates smoother logistics operations.
Toughness and Safety:
- Like other standardized containers, the 45' container is constructed to endure the rigors of international shipping. It is equipped with robust locking systems and is designed to secure 45ft cargo containers securely throughout transit.
Common Uses of 45' Containers
Bulk Goods:
- The increased capacity of the 45' container makes it perfect for carrying bulk goods such as basic materials, commodities, and big amounts of consumer products.
Disposable Goods:
- Refrigerated 45' containers are utilized to transport temperature-sensitive items, ensuring they stay fresh and safe throughout the journey.
Large and Heavy Cargo:
- Open top and flat rack 45' containers are perfect for transporting extra-large and heavy products that can not fit into basic containers.
Retail and E-commerce:
- Retailers and e-commerce business frequently use 45' containers to deliver big volumes of stock, lowering the variety of deliveries required and optimizing logistics expenses.
Industrial and Construction Materials:
- The 45' container is frequently Used 45ft containers in the industrial and building and construction sectors to transfer products such as equipment, steel, and construction equipment.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What is the difference between a 40' and a 45' container?
- A 45' container is 5 feet longer than a 40' container, supplying an extra 450 cubic feet of cargo area. This additional space can be beneficial for services that need to transfer big volumes of items.
Q: Are 45' containers more costly than 40' containers?
- The cost of a 45' container can be somewhat greater than a 40' container due to its increased size. However, the cost per cubic foot of cargo area is typically lower, making it more cost-effective for large deliveries.
Q: Can 45' containers be loaded onto basic trucks and railcars?
- Yes, 45' containers are created to be suitable with standard container handling equipment, including cranes, trucks, and railcars. Nevertheless, some adjustments might be essential to accommodate the longer length, such as using a drop deck trailer for roadway transportation.
Q: Are 45' containers suitable for air cargo?
- 45' containers are primarily designed for maritime and ground transportation. For air freight, smaller and lighter containers are normally Used 45ft containers to fulfill the weight and size constraints of airplane.
Q: How do I determine if a 45' container is the right option for my company?
- To identify if a 45' container is appropriate for your requirements, consider the volume and type of cargo you are shipping. If you consistently deliver large volumes of products or need extra area for large products, a 45' container may be the best option. Speak with a logistics professional to evaluate your particular requirements and budget.
Q: Are there any unique guidelines for shipping with 45' containers?
- While 45' containers adhere to international shipping requirements, some ports and shipping paths might have particular regulations or restrictions concerning their use. It is important to consult your shipping service provider and pertinent authorities to make sure compliance with all regulations.
